Out-of-step prediction using dqn-based disturbance observer and its rtds verification

HIGHLIGHTS

  • who: Sun Jick Yang and collaborators from the (UNIVERSITY) have published the research work: Out-of-Step Prediction Using DQN-Based Disturbance Observer and Its RTDS Verification, in the Journal: Energies 2022, 15, 2652. of 14/08/2003
  • what: This paper proposes a synchronous OOS prediction algorithm for a SMIB power transmission system.
  • how: Aiming to contribute to this research area this paper proposes a synchronous detection algorithm that uses a deep Q-network-based disturbance robust to measurement noise. The analysis of EAC was further modified into the extended equal area criterion . . .
